The River
The beauty of the River, it's meaning and value, are reflected in this tapestry. Water, rolling, flowing, carrying silt, pebbles, leaves, animals, fish and birds; circumscribing the landscape; each drop, part of the whole The journey of the river is an apt metaphor for our lives. The element of water is a substance so close to our own being that without it, we are not. Poets write about it, singers honor with liquid sound the passage and flow. In this tapestry, I try to express the vibrancy and necessity of one of our most important resources. As poet Claudia Schmidt writes,
